2013-01-18 5 views
8

내 Android지도 API V2로 내 앱을 업데이트하고 현재 표시된지도의 비트 맵 이미지를 가져 오는 중에 문제가 발생했습니다. API의 V1에서 나는과 같이 이런 짓을 :Android에서 MapView 비트 맵을 얻는 방법 Google Maps API V2

API의 V1에서 Whilest
Bitmap mBitmap; 
MapViwe mMapView; 
// ... 
mBitmap = Bitmap.createBitmap(MAP_WIDTH, MAP_HEIGHT, Bitmap.Config.ARGB_8888); 
Canvas canvas = new Canvas(mBitmap); 
mMapView.draw(canvas); 

, 이것이 내가 얻을 모두 검은 색 직사각형, API의 V2에, 나에게지도의 비트 맵을 얻었다.

또한 API V2에서는 이 아닌 MapView을 사용하고 있으므로 문제가되지 않습니다.

답변

-1

이 링크를 읽으십시오 Google Map API. 읽기 후에는 Google API에서 비트 맵을 가져올 수 있습니다. 나는 그것이 당신을 도울 수 있기를 바랍니다 .... 감사합니다

+0

죄송합니다. 링크는 웹 사이트의지도 용입니다. 나는 그것이 어떻게 든 안드로이드를 위해 작동한다고 생각하지만, 방법은 단지 위치를 보내고 확대하고지도 이미지를 돌려받는 것이다. 그러나지도에 그려진 오버레이 (트랙, 마일스톤, ...)도 필요합니다. 그리고 제안한 API로는이를 달성 할 수 없습니다. – Ridcully

관련 문제